Here are the stone's specs:

Basic info: 1.554 J/SI1 (AGSL report from 01/2006) with HCA of 1.2 (EX, EX, EX, VG)
Crown angle/%: 34.4/14.9%
Pavillion angle/%: 40.8/43.1%
Table %: 56.5%
Depth %: 61.1%
Girdle: thin to slightly thick, faceted, 1.2 - 4.0%
Culet: pointed
Dimensions: 7.43 x 7.51 x 4.56 mm

Diamondseeker, BlueNile did not tell me it was a hearts & arrows diamond - I bought it primarily based off of the AGSL report (which I somewhat regret as an amateurish move) and HCA score. So plainly put, I did not know whether it would be a true hearts and arrows cut diamond. BN sent me the diamond over a couple weeks ago and personally I couldn't see the arrows/hearts but that's more likely due to me being amateurish (perhaps I didn't observe the diamond in proper lighting conditions and/or viewing angles?).

I also was a little confident that an AGS ideal would be sufficient - I checked GOG and WhiteFlash's inhouse selections and every single AGS ideal cut stone they had displayed perfect arrows.

Maybe it was a gamble to begin with but with a 30-day no-hassles return policy, it's not so bad in the end (WhiteFlash for example has a whopping 20% restocking fee).
